I have several Riolis kits, and I think they are lovely. The only problem I have with their threads is that they tend to wear out (shred, fuzz, etc) more quickly, especially on a stiff fabric. I have dealt with this primarily by switching out the fabric to a softer linen and using shorter lengths of thread. Your owl is coming along beautifully and from where I sit your stitches look very nice. I think when we examine our work, it's up close and we see every bit of unevenness caused by uncooperative threads. However, people will be looking at our work from 3-5 feet away from the piece and from there this project and others will look beautiful.
